Skyrim
0 of 0

File information

Last updated

Original upload

Created by

Evil4Zerggin

Uploaded by

Evil4Zerggin

Virus scan

Safe to use

XP script source code (1 comment)

  1. Evil4Zerggin
    Evil4Zerggin
    • member
    • 3 kudos
    Scriptname VoiceSpeechAdvanceScript extends ActiveMagicEffect

    float Property advanceMultiplier = 5.0 Auto

    Event OnEffectStart (Actor akTarget, Actor akCaster)
    if akCaster == Game.GetPlayer() && akCaster.IsInCombat()
    float srm = akCaster.GetActorValue("ShoutRecoveryMult")
    if srm <= 0.1
    srm = 0.1
    endif
    Game.AdvanceSkill("Speechcraft", advanceMultiplier * akCaster.GetVoiceRecoveryTime() / srm)
    endif
    EndEvent